The list … Web17 feb. 2024 · Accounting ratio is the comparison of two or more financial data which are used for analyzing the financial statements of companies. It is an effective tool used by the shareholders, creditors and all kinds of stakeholders to understand the profitability, strength and financial status of companies. This is also widely known as financial ratios ...

WebAccounting ratios are indicators of a commercial entity’s performance and financial situation. We calculate the majority of ratios from data that the firm’s financial statements provide. Financial ratio sources could be the balance sheet, income statement, or statement of cash flows. The statement of changes in equity is also a source. WebLiquidity Ratios measure the extent to which an organisation is capable of converting assets into cash and cash equivalents. On the other hand, Gearing Ratios measure the dependence of an organisation on external financing as against shareholder funds. Liquidity and Gearing Ratios are outlined below: Liquidity. Web19 sep. 2024 · 1. Liquidity Ratios: When ratio is calculated to judge the ability of the concern to meet out its current liabilities out of its current assets is called liquidity ratios. 2.
